While Cities: Skylines is much better and more popular than the last SimCity, there is one more thing that the Maxis developers have done better. We are talking about convenient mechanics that will make the process of creating and improving the city more efficient and faster.

So far, he’s only been seen in a gameplay trailer, the creators haven’t bragged about it yet, but it seems that in Cities: Horizons 2 there will be water pipes under the road. It’s the blue color next to the road icon. On the contrary, the orange color is surprising. This may indicate inclusion of seasonswhen the city needs to be heated. Then more brown under the road. Maybe it’s about power line.

In any case, it seems like a simplification, we will no longer create roads and water supply separately. Instead, we will build everything with a single mouse (or gamepad) movement. We’ll see when Colossal Order shares this news. After all, Cities: Skylines 2 is due out this year on P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X/S. The game will be available on Game Pass on the same day.
